Update on
Relocation of the Shooting Range
The
old shooting range was in operation at the same location without any problems
for over 40 years. Unfortunately the old shooting range is no more and
has been permanently closed. The land that it was on is within the area
Airdrie aims to annex into its city boundaries.
The
Airdrie Revolver and Pistol Club has been invited to
relocate the shooting range to a new location which is approximately 16 km.
east and 5 km. north of Airdrie. We propose to build a 50 meter pistol
and 100 – 200 yard rifle range with 12 positions each at this location.
The RCMP Canadian Firearms Program Range Officer has viewed the proposed new
shooting range site and advised that firearms can be safely discharged at this
location if it is built to meet their Range Design and Construction
Guidelines. We are in the early stages of preparing the submission of the
Rezoning Designation Application and Development Permit required by the
Municipal District of Rocky View for the shooting range to be relocated and
built on this site. This is a six to eight month process. If
approval is given this will be a welcome major project for the club and its
members. At this early stage we do not have an estimate of costs but it
is obvious the club will need all the help and financial support we can get.
